服务器性能和配置的重要性详解

一、引言
随着信息技术的飞速发展,服务器在现代社会中的作用日益重要。
从云计算到大数据,再到物联网和人工智能,无不依赖于高性能的服务器。
服务器的性能和配置成为确保服务质量、提升工作效率和保障数据安全的关键因素。
本文将详细探讨服务器性能和配置的重要性,帮助读者更好地理解其背后的原理和选择标准。
二、服务器性能的重要性
1. 服务质量
服务器的性能直接影响服务质量。
高性能的服务器能够在处理大量请求时保持高效稳定,提供更快的数据处理速度和更高的并发能力。
反之,性能不足的服务器可能导致响应速度慢、处理效率低下,严重影响用户体验和业务运行。
2. 工作效率
服务器性能对工作效率有着重要影响。
在高性能服务器的支持下,企业能够实现更快速的数据处理、更高效的业务运营和更便捷的沟通协作。
这有助于企业降低成本、提高生产力,从而提升整体竞争力。
三、服务器配置的重要性
1. 满足需求
合理的服务器配置是满足业务需求的基础。
根据业务类型、规模和未来发展需求,选择适当的硬件配置和软件配置,能够确保服务器在处理各类任务时具备足够的性能。
2. 数据安全
服务器配置对数据安全具有重要影响。
通过合理的配置,可以确保服务器的稳定性、可靠性和安全性。
例如,采用高性能的处理器和足够的内存有助于提升服务器的处理能力,从而降低因负载过大导致的安全漏洞风险。
同时,安装必要的安全软件、设置防火墙和定期备份数据等措施,也是保障数据安全的重要配置手段。
四、服务器性能与配置的关联性
服务器的性能和配置密切相关。
一方面,高性能的硬件配置为服务器提供了强大的处理能力,使其在处理各类任务时表现出更高的效率和稳定性。
另一方面,合理的软件配置能够优化服务器的性能,提升其在特定应用场景下的表现。
因此,在选择服务器时,需要根据实际需求综合考虑硬件和软件配置,以实现最佳的性能表现。
五、如何选择适当的服务器配置
1. 明确业务需求
在选择服务器配置前,首先要明确业务需求。
了解业务类型、规模和发展方向,以确定服务器需要处理的任务量和数据类型。
2. 评估现有硬件和软件资源
评估现有硬件和软件资源,了解现有系统的性能和瓶颈。
这有助于确定需要升级的硬件配置和软件配置。
3. 选择合适的处理器、内存和存储
根据业务需求,选择合适的处理器、内存和存储配置。
处理器性能、内存容量和存储速度是影响服务器性能的关键因素。
4. 考虑网络带宽和扩展性
在选择服务器配置时,还要考虑网络带宽和扩展性。
足够的网络带宽能够确保服务器在处理大量请求时保持高效稳定,而良好的扩展性则有助于应对业务增长带来的挑战。
5. 选择合适的操作系统和软件
根据业务需求和应用场景,选择合适的操作系统和软件配置。
这有助于优化服务器性能,提高数据处理效率和安全性。
六、结论
服务器的性能和配置是确保服务质量、提升工作效率和保障数据安全的关键因素。
在选择服务器时,需要根据业务需求、现有资源、硬件配置、软件配置等多方面因素进行综合考虑。
通过合理的配置选择,可以确保服务器在应对各类任务时具备足够的性能,为企业的发展提供有力支持。
求13000元网络游戏服务器配置清单、不是专业的请不要回答、谢谢
你这种需要服务器配置比较高才行,因为在线1000人不会卡,对服务器的cpu性能,内存容量,磁盘读写性能要求都比较高,而对存储容量要求不高。
所以推荐你看看国产品牌正睿的这款双路四核服务器。
标配一颗至强E5620四核八线程处理器(2.4GHz/5.86GT/12M缓存),英特尔5500服务器芯片组主板,4G DDR3 REG ECC 1333MHz内存,SSD 120G高性能固态硬盘,4个热插拔盘位,允许用户在不关闭服务器的情况下增加或减少硬盘,便于维护,双千兆网卡,性能可以说是非常不错。
如果以后随着业务量的增长,觉得性能不够用了,还可以扩展到两颗处理器,达成8颗处理核心,16条处理线程(在任务管理器处能看到16个处理核心的格子- -~很NB),最大支持48GB DDR3 REG ECC高速容错校验内存。
产品型号:IS-H 产品类型:双路四核机架式服务器处 理 器:Xeon E5620内存:4G DDR3 REG ECC硬盘:SSD 120G机构:1U机架式 价格:¥8999
银牌服务
全国三年免费上门售后服务,关键部件三年以上免费质保。
如果预算在-之间,那么可以考虑增加到2个cpu,8G DDR3 REG ECC1333MHz,总价也就在左右搞定。
给你推荐的是国产品牌正睿的服务器产品,他们的产品性价比很高,做工很专业,兼容性,质量之类的都有保障,售后也很完善,3年免费质保,3年免费上门售后服务,在业界口碑很不错。
增加带宽和服务器硬件可以防御DDoS吗?
展开全部增加带宽和服务器硬件的确可以缓解DDoS攻击,当你的带宽大于攻击者的攻击流量就可以无视攻击了,但是DDoS攻击的流量成本非常低,而带宽和硬件的成本却非常高,当攻击者发起成倍增加的大流量攻击时,靠增加带宽来防御是不太现实的,除非你超级超级有钱。
最合理的防御方式是选择接入网络高防,就拿墨者.安全的高防来说,1000G的攻击流量都可以防住,国内一般的攻击流量是几十G最多到几百G,所以1000G的防御流量等级是完全可以保证安全了。
如何区分HTTP协议的无状态和长连接?
HTTP是无状态的也就是说,浏览器和服务器每进行一次HTTP操作,就建立一次连接,但任务结束就中断连接。
如果客户端浏览器访问的某个HTML或其他类型的 Web页中包含有其他的Web资源,如JavaScript文件、图像文件、CSS文件等;当浏览器每遇到这样一个Web资源,就会建立一个HTTP会话 HTTP1.1和HTTP1.0相比较而言,最大的区别就是增加了持久连接支持(貌似最新的 http1.0 可以显示的指定 keep-alive),但还是无状态的,或者说是不可以信任的。
如果浏览器或者服务器在其头信息加入了这行代码 Connection:keep-alive TCP连接在发送后将仍然保持打开状态,于是,浏览器可以继续通过相同的连接发送请求。
保持连接节省了为每个请求建立新连接所需的时间,还节约了带宽。
实现长连接要客户端和服务端都支持长连接。
所谓长连接指建立SOCKET连接后不管是否使用都保持连接,但安全性较差,所谓短连接指建立SOCKET连接后发送后接收完数据后马上断开连接,一般银行都使用短连接短连接:比如http的,只是连接、请求、关闭,过程时间较短,服务器若是一段时间内没有收到请求即可关闭连接。
长连接:有些服务需要长时间连接到服务器,比如CMPP,一般需要自己做在线维持。
最近在看“服务器推送技术”,在B/S结构中,通过某种magic使得客户端不需要通过轮询即可以得到服务端的最新信息(比如股票价格),这样可以节省大量的带宽。
传统的轮询技术对服务器的压力很大,并且造成带宽的极大浪费。
如果改用ajax轮询,可以降低带宽的负荷(因为服务器返回的不是完整页面),但是对服务器的压力并不会有明显的减少。
而推技术(push)可以改善这种情况。
但因为HTTP连接的特性(短暂,必须由客户端发起),使得推技术的实现比较困难,常见的做法是通过延长http 连接的寿命,来实现push。
接下来自然该讨论如何延长http连接的寿命,最简单的自然是死循环法:【servlet代码片段】public void doGet(Request req, Response res) {PrintWriter out = ();……正常输出页面……();while (true) {(输出更新的内容);();(3000);} }如果使用观察者模式则可以进一步提高性能。
但是这种做法的缺点在于客户端请求了这个servlet后,web服务器会开启一个线程执行servlet的代码,而servlet由迟迟不肯结束,造成该线程也无法被释放。
于是乎,一个客户端一个线程,当客户端数量增加时,服务器依然会承受很大的负担。
要从根本上改变这个现象比较复杂,目前的趋势是从web服务器内部入手,用nio(JDK 1.4提出的包)改写request/response的实现,再利用线程池增强服务器的资源利用率,从而解决这个问题,目前支持这一非J2EE官方技术的服务器有Glassfish和Jetty(后者只是听说,没有用过)
高防云服务器/独立服务器联系QQ:262730666














